How to Measure a Dog for a Harness

Measuring your dog for a harness is a process that requires precision, care, and a touch of patience. Don’t worry, we will walk you through this step-by-step so that your beloved companion can enjoy a harness that enhances their comfort and mobility.

Step #1: Gather Your Tools

Before you begin, gather the tools you'll need: a flexible measuring tape, a notepad, and a pen. Having these essentials at hand streamlines the process, ensuring accuracy and efficiency.

Step #2: Measure the Neck

Starting with the neck, gently place the measuring tape around the base – where the collar typically sits. Ensure that you maintain a snug yet comfortable fit. Record this measurement on your notepad, as it forms the foundation for the perfect harness fit.

Step #3: Measure the Chest

Move on to the chest, wrapping the measuring tape around the widest part – typically right behind the front legs. The tape should be parallel to the ground and snug enough to provide accurate measurements without causing discomfort.

Step #4: Determine the Girth

The girth measurement encompasses the circumference of your dog's body – a vital dimension that contributes to harness stability. Start by placing the measuring tape behind the front legs and around the body's widest point. Ensure that the tape is snug but not tight. Record this measurement alongside the others, completing the trifecta of dimensions that tailor your harness.

With these measurements in hand, you can accurately fit your dog's harness, optimizing ease and support. Remember, a well-fitted harness offers not only comfort for your furry friend but also the freedom to explore the world alongside you.

What Types of Harnesses Are Available?

Harnesses come in various styles, each tailored to cater to different needs and preferences. It is up to you which you select for your dog. However, there are some suggestions based on your pup’s behavior, size, and unique needs.

Here are a few common types to consider:

  • Back-Clip Harness: This type features a D-ring located on the back, providing moderate control and reducing pressure on the neck. It's a great option for dogs who walk calmly on a leash.
  • Front-Clip Harness: With the D-ring placed on the front, this harness discourages pulling by redirecting the dog's attention towards you. It's ideal for dogs in training or those who tend to pull.
  • No-Pull Harness: Designed to minimize pulling, this harness often features both front and back D-rings, offering additional control and training opportunities.
  • Step-In Harness: This type is particularly easy to put on, requiring your dog to step into the harness before securing it around their body.
  • Vest Harness: Offering more coverage and support, vest-style harnesses are comfortable options for dogs with respiratory issues or those prone to pulling.

Benefits of Dog Harnesses Over Collars

Dog harnesses bring a myriad of benefits to both you and your four-legged friend. Let's explore a few compelling reasons to opt for a harness:

  • Reduced Strain: Unlike collars, harnesses distribute pressure evenly across your dog's body, reducing strain on the neck and minimizing discomfort.
  • Control: Harnesses offer better control, especially for dogs who tend to pull. They provide a comfortable way to guide your dog during walks.
  • Safety: Harnesses reduce the risk of injury, particularly for dogs with respiratory issues or delicate necks.
  • Training: Certain harness types can aid in training, discouraging pulling and promoting better walking behavior.

What is the difference between a no-pull harness and a pull harness?

The distinction lies in their purpose. A no-pull harness is designed to discourage pulling by redirecting your dog's attention, making walks more enjoyable. A pull harness, on the other hand, is typically used in dog sports or activities where pulling is encouraged, like sled pulling or weight-pulling competitions.

Why is a harness better than a leash?

A harness offers multiple advantages over a traditional collar and leash. It distributes pressure more evenly across your dog's body, reducing strain on the neck. This is especially important for dogs prone to respiratory issues or those who tend to pull. Additionally, a harness provides better control during walks and promotes a more comfortable and enjoyable experience for both you and your dog.
